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Global Variables Directly Accessed |  Label References |  Local Variables  | All
Print Page as PDF
Routine: SROESNR

Package: Surgery

Routine: SROESNR


Information

SROESNR ;BIR/ADM - NURSE INTRAOP REPORT E-SIG UTILITY ; [ 02/20/02 6:57 AM ]

Source Information

Source file <SROESNR.m>

Call Graph

Call Graph

Call Graph Total: 4

Package Total Call Graph
Surgery 4 VIEW^SROESNR0  MULT^SROESNR1  ^SROESNR2  MULT^SROESNR3  

Caller Graph

Legends:

Legend of Colors

Package Component Superscript legend

action A extended action Ea event driver Ed subscriber Su protocol O limited protocol LP run routine RR broker B edit E server Se print P screenman SM inquire I

Caller Graph

Caller Graph Total: 1

Package Total Caller Graph
Surgery 1 SROES  

Entry Points

Name Comments DBIA/ICR reference
IN
EX
GET
MULT ; get data from multiples
COMP ; compare before and after view
CMULT ; process multiples
PASS1 ; delete nodes for unchanged fields except for .01 fields
PASS2 ; delete .01 nodes of sub-multiples if no changes underneath - before or after
PASS3 ; delete .01 nodes for top level multiples if no changes underneath
PASS4 ; set up list of changed fields for display in addendum

External References

Name Field # of Occurrence
VIEW^SROESNR0 GET
MULT^SROESNR1 MULT+2
^SROESNR2 EX+1
MULT^SROESNR3 MULT+3

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^TMP("SRNRAD" GET!, COMP+4, COMP+5, COMP+6!, COMP+8!, CMULT+2, CMULT+3, CMULT+4, CMULT+5, PASS1+1
PASS1+2, PASS1+5, PASS1+6, PASS1+7!, PASS1+8, PASS1+9!, PASS2+2, PASS2+3, PASS2+4, PASS2+5
PASS2+6, PASS2+7!, PASS2+8!, PASS3+1, PASS3+3, PASS3+4, PASS3+5, PASS3+6!, PASS4+1, PASS4+3
PASS4+4, PASS4+5, PASS4+6, PASS4+7
^TMP("SRNRAD1" EX+1, COMP+2, COMP+7
^TMP("SRNRAD2" EX+1, COMP+7
^TMP("SRNRMULT" CMULT+1!, PASS4+4*, PASS4+5*, PASS4+6*, PASS4+7*

Label References

Name Line Occurrences
COMP EX
GET INEX
MULT GET
PASS1 CMULT+2
PASS2 CMULT+3
PASS3 CMULT+4
PASS4 CMULT+5

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
SRCHNG COMP+1~, COMP+2*, COMP+4, COMP+5*, COMP+6, COMP+7*, COMP+8, PASS1+2*, PASS1+5, PASS1+6*
PASS1+7, PASS1+8*, PASS1+9
SRE COMP+1~, PASS1+1*, PASS1+2, PASS1+5, PASS1+6, PASS1+7, PASS1+8, PASS1+9, PASS2+2*, PASS2+3
PASS2+4, PASS2+5, PASS2+6, PASS2+7, PASS2+8, PASS3+1*, PASS3+3, PASS3+4, PASS3+5, PASS3+6
PASS4+1*, PASS4+3, PASS4+4, PASS4+5, PASS4+6, PASS4+7
SRE1 COMP+1~, PASS1+1*, PASS1+2, PASS1+5, PASS1+6, PASS1+7, PASS1+8, PASS1+9, PASS2+2*, PASS2+3
PASS2+4, PASS2+5, PASS2+6, PASS2+7, PASS2+8, PASS4+1*, PASS4+3, PASS4+4, PASS4+5, PASS4+6
PASS4+7
SRE2 COMP+1~
SRFLD COMP+1~, COMP+2*, COMP+3, COMP+4, COMP+5, COMP+6, COMP+7, COMP+8, PASS1+2*, PASS1+3
PASS1+4, PASS1+5, PASS1+6, PASS1+7, PASS1+8, PASS1+9, PASS2+3*, PASS2+4, PASS2+5, PASS2+6
PASS2+7, PASS2+8, PASS3+1*, PASS3+2, PASS3+3, PASS3+4, PASS3+6, PASS4+1*, PASS4+2, PASS4+3
PASS4+4, PASS4+5, PASS4+6, PASS4+7
SRK MULT+1~, MULT+2*, MULT+3*
SRLN COMP+1~, COMP+4*, COMP+5, PASS1+5*, PASS1+6, PASS4+3*, PASS4+4, PASS4+5
SRMULT COMP+1~, CMULT+2*, CMULT+3*, CMULT+4*, CMULT+5*, PASS1+1, PASS1+2, PASS1+5, PASS1+6, PASS1+7
PASS1+8, PASS1+9, PASS2+2, PASS2+3, PASS2+4, PASS2+5, PASS2+6, PASS2+7, PASS2+8, PASS3+1
PASS3+3, PASS3+4, PASS3+5, PASS3+6, PASS4+1, PASS4+3, PASS4+4, PASS4+5, PASS4+6, PASS4+7
SRNXT1 PASS2+1~, PASS2+5*, PASS2+7, PASS2+8
SRNXT2 PASS2+1~, PASS2+6*, PASS2+7, PASS2+8
SROTH COMP+1~, COMP+4*, COMP+5, CMULT+2*, CMULT+3*, CMULT+4*, CMULT+5*, PASS1+5*, PASS1+6, PASS1+8*
PASS2+4, PASS2+6, PASS2+7, PASS2+8, PASS3+3, PASS3+4, PASS3+5, PASS3+6, PASS4+5, PASS4+7
SRS IN~*, EX~*, GETCOMP+1~, COMP+4*, COMP+5, COMP+6*, COMP+8*, CMULT+1*, CMULT+2*
CMULT+3*, CMULT+4*, CMULT+5*, PASS1+1, PASS1+2, PASS1+8, PASS2+2, PASS2+3, PASS2+4, PASS2+5
PASS2+7, PASS2+8, PASS3+1, PASS3+3, PASS3+4, PASS3+5, PASS3+6, PASS4+1, PASS4+3, PASS4+4
PASS4+6
SRS1 COMP+1~, PASS1+5*, PASS1+6, PASS1+7*, PASS1+9*
>> SRTN EX+1, GETCOMP+2, COMP+4, COMP+5, COMP+6, COMP+7, COMP+8, CMULT+1, CMULT+2
CMULT+3, CMULT+4, CMULT+5, PASS1+1, PASS1+2, PASS1+5, PASS1+6, PASS1+7, PASS1+8, PASS1+9
PASS2+2, PASS2+3, PASS2+4, PASS2+5, PASS2+6, PASS2+7, PASS2+8, PASS3+1, PASS3+3, PASS3+4
PASS3+5, PASS3+6, PASS4+1, PASS4+3, PASS4+4, PASS4+5, PASS4+6, PASS4+7
SRY1 PASS2+1~, PASS2+8*
SRY2 PASS2+1~, PASS2+8*
X COMP+1~
>> Y PASS1+3*, PASS3+2*
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Global Variables Directly Accessed |  Label References |  Local Variables  | All